Idaho Tuition for Medical Office Assistant/Specialist

3 Idaho colleges have the Medical Office Assistant/Specialist program, and all the schools are public.
1 schools offer the Medical Office Assistant/Specialist program granting BS degrees in undergraduate schools. The average tuition & fees for BS Medical Office Assistant/Specialist program is $7,388 for state residents and $21,386 for out-of-state students for the academic year 2023-2024.
Of the 3 colleges, 1 school offers online degree and/or courses for Medical Office Assistant/Specialist program.
